## Detected AI/LLM Bots

The package specializes in detecting these AI and search bots:

### OpenAI Bots
- **OAI-SearchBot**: OpenAI SearchBot for linking and surfacing websites in ChatGPT search results
- **ChatGPT-User**: ChatGPT user actions and Custom GPTs web interactions  
- **GPTBot**: OpenAI GPTBot for training generative AI foundation models

### Search Engines
- **Googlebot**: Google web crawler for search indexing

### Additional AI Bots
- **Claude-Web**: Anthropic Claude web interactions
- **Bard**: Google Bard AI interactions
- **AI Bot**: Generic AI or bot-like user agents

### Manual Bot Detection
```javascript
const { detectBotFromUserAgent } = require('bear-tracker');

const userAgent = 'Mozilla/5.0 A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ko); compatible; GPTBot/1.1; +https://openai.com/gptbot';
const result = detectBotFromUserAgent(userAgent);

console.log(result);
// {
//   name: 'GPTBot',
//   type: 'ai_training', 
//   isBot: true,
//   userAgent: '...',
//   timestamp: 2024-01-01T12:00:00.000Z,
//   description: 'OpenAI GPTBot for training generative AI foundation models'
// }
```

## Log Output Format

The structured logs are perfect for Vercel and other serverless platforms:

```json
{
  "timestamp": "2024-01-01T12:00:00.000Z",
  "bot_detected": true,
  "bot_name": "GPTBot",
  "bot_type": "ai_training",
  "bot_description": "OpenAI GPTBot for training generative AI foundation models",
  "user_agent": "Mozilla/5.0 A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ko); compatible; GPTBot/1.1...",
  "ip_address": "40.84.180.224"
}
```

## API Reference

### `createBotTracker(logLevel?)`
Quick setup function that tracks only AI bots.
- `logLevel`: `'info' | 'warn' | 'error'` (default: `'info'`)

### `createCustomBotTracker(customLogger)`
Setup with custom logging function.
- `customLogger`: `(botInfo: BotInfo) => void`

### `BotTracker(options?)`
Full-featured class with configuration options.

### `detectBotFromUserAgent(userAgent)`
Manually detect if a user-agent string belongs to an AI bot.
